In the precision equipment used in the medical device industry, accurate temperature management is required. Additionally, it is necessary to overcome various challenges such as space and weight issues. Polyimide heaters are thin, flexible, and have excellent chemical resistance. They can uniformly adjust surface temperatures, raise temperatures in specific areas, or design temperature distributions as needed. Custom-made options are available, allowing you to specify dimensions and specifications. 【Application Scenarios】 - Body temperature sensors - Biological response measurement - Medical imaging diagnostic devices, etc. 【Benefits of Implementation】 - Contributes to miniaturization and weight reduction - Flexible shape improves adherence to measurement areas - Provides a stable temperature environment
